Anxiety In The Math Classroom, Jean Benner Aug 2010

Anxiety In The Math Classroom, Jean Benner

Mathematics Graduate Theses

Math anxiety is a learned response that inhibits cognitive performance in the math classroom. It is widespread among students from elementary age through college. Students suffering from math anxiety have difficulty performing calculations and maintaining a positive outlook on mathematics. Math anxiety is the result of a cycle of math avoidance that begins with negative experiences regarding mathematics. Facts pertaining to math anxiety are discussed and strategies are suggested to assist teachers in helping students to overcome math anxiety or avoid the phenomenon altogether.

Hungary And The United States: A Comparison Of Gifted Education, Julianna Connelly Stockton Jan 2009

Hungary And The United States: A Comparison Of Gifted Education, Julianna Connelly Stockton

Mathematics Faculty Publications

There is a lot that can be learned about a country based on the programs and provisions it has for mathematically talented students. While it is difficult to identify a single U.S. "program" or "approach" for gifted education, in general the trend is to put mathematically talented students through the standard mathematics sequence, just starting at an earlier age. In Hungary, on the other hand, the focus is on enrichment over acceleration. This paper explores how some very different historical, cultural, and political forces have shaped these two countries’ different approaches to educating mathematically talented students.


Are The Math Scores Of Students Who Are Taught Mathematics Utilizing The Methods Endorsed By The Alabama Math, Science, And Technology Initiative Affected?, Brenda Elise Jolly Dec 2008

Are The Math Scores Of Students Who Are Taught Mathematics Utilizing The Methods Endorsed By The Alabama Math, Science, And Technology Initiative Affected?, Brenda Elise Jolly

Dissertations

Eighth-grade mathematics scores from 21 schools were compared pre-inception and post-inception of the Alabama Mathematics, Science, and Technology Initiative (AMSTI). Only the scores from schools which had 80% of their mathematics and science teachers trained at one Summer Institute were used, as these were considered to be true AMSTI schools. Results found the effects of AMSTI to be not statistically significant.

Effects Of Points Exchangeable For Grades On Junior High Mathematics Students, James Edward Perkins Mar 1972

Effects Of Points Exchangeable For Grades On Junior High Mathematics Students, James Edward Perkins

Master of Education Theses

This paper presents the effects of a token system used in a regular eighth grade mathematics class. Two classes containing 21 and 23 students were implemented. The study was designed to increase attendance, behavior, and mathematical achievement in a test group and measure the effects against a control group. The scores revealed a significant difference only in attendance favoring the test group.

Recommendations included pairing stronger reinforcers with the points used and suggestions for future research.


Traditional Vs. Individualized Fifth And Sixth Grade Arithmetic Program, Donald Paul Giaudrone Jan 1972

Traditional Vs. Individualized Fifth And Sixth Grade Arithmetic Program, Donald Paul Giaudrone

All Master's Theses

This paper presents a comparative study involving two methods of arithmetic instruction for fifth and sixth grade students. Thirty pupils were taught arithmetic using a traditional approach and thirty pupils were taught arithmetic using an individualized approach. Each group was divided into high, average, and low ability students and between group achievements compared at the end of an eight month period with encouraging results. Evaluation and statistical analysis followed. The findings were discussed and recommendations offered for further study.
